Faultless

January 16, 2014 by Sweetpsychosis 4 Comments

It is not often that you find a perfect book. I didn’t find this one, I was told to read it by a dear friend (popcultureboy) and am very glad I did. My Sister-in-Law died young and brutally fast from a brain tumour in February 2013 and after that I was directed by well meaning souls to all sorts of ‘cancer’ books.  So at first I was a bit wary because in this book “despite the tumor-shrinking medical miracle that has bought her a few […]

CB VI #2: The Fault in Our Stars

January 9, 2014 by lowercasesee 2 Comments

I kind of wish I could sue John Green for emotional damages because this book fucking broke me. I’m talking, full-on, Clair-Danes-worthy-ugly-crying-alone-in-bed broke me. Ugh. I mean, in a good way. But still. I haven’t fully recovered from this book. Hands-down, Hazel’s dad is one of my favorite dads in literature. I love my father, I have the best dad in the history of ever, but if you offered to let me swap for Hazel’s dad, I’d have to stop and consider it. There’s a […]

The Faults in this Book

January 8, 2014 by riverdawn10 Leave a Comment

  The Fault in Our Stars is the story of Hazel Grace Lancaster, a 17-year-old girl with terminal thyroid cancer, and her boyfriend, Augustus Waters. It’s a smart book without a lot of beef in the storyline. Read full review here.
